THE MULTIFAMILY IMPACT COUNCIL THE MULTIFAMILY IMPACT COUNCIL WORKS TO ESTABLISH AND MAINTAIN MULTIFAMILY IMPACT INVESTMENTS AS A CREDIBLE, WIDELY ACCEPTED ASSET CLASS TO HELP INCREASE GLOBAL IMPACT CAPITAL FLOW INTO AFFORDABLE AND SUSTAINABLE RENTAL HOUSING IN THE UNITED STATES.
THE MULTIFAMILY IMPACT COUNCIL has received 2 grants from 2 known foundation funders. Revenue increased from $592,134 in 2023 to $794,295 in 2024. Most recent reported revenue: $794,295.
